MEMO – Orlan Civic Annex Project

To: Receiving site, Dunmere Yard

The stamped blueprints for the building permit application ship tomorrow via Kessler Freight, single tube, marked PLAN SET C. These are the only signed originals; the permit office will not accept copies. Do not open the tube on site. Receiving clerk signs the manifest, logs the time, and stores the tube in the plans cabinet until the permit runner collects it Thursday.

At the courier hand-over, the receiving clerk must do the following:

handover note for yagef-bagep: the drudor pelius courier leaves the kasdor zorvan norir ledger at gate 8016 under passcode 755406

Subject: Handover — Snapvault image cache leak

Rell,

Short version for your review: the Snapvault image cache leaks roughly 200MB/hour under sustained thumbnail traffic. Root cause looks like decoded bitmaps pinned by the eviction listener — listener holds strong refs past eviction. Patch in branch leak-fix-evict swaps to weak refs and adds a teardown hook. Repro script is in /tools/leakgen; run it against staging, not prod. Heap dumps from last night are in the diagnostics schema. Staging DB is reachable with the connection string below.

replica DSN, tawef-hahap: mysql://eliix_svc:FiIC0jz@db-394a.lumiclabs.internal:5432/holius

## Step 2: Enable role-based access on Quillstone

With the content migration from the old wiki complete, the next step is turning on Quillstone's role-based access model. New team members should know that every space now maps to one of three roles — reader, contributor, and steward — and that permissions are inherited down the page tree unless explicitly overridden. Before flipping the enforcement flag, confirm your local instance matches the shared baseline. The baseline configuration for this step is as follows.

deployment values, faduf-tawep:
SORDOR_LOG_LEVEL=error
SORDOR_METRICS_HOST=metrics.sordor.nelvrolabs.internal
SORDOR_POOL_SIZE=4

Hey folks — quick update on the Kettleworth image slimming work. We dropped the base layer to the minimal runtime, stripped debug symbols, and the Portview service image is now about 60% smaller. New contractors: pull from the slim tag, not latest, until we flip the default next sprint. The build token for the slim candidate is right below.

pipeline stamp: htk3_69f